RISC-V: La arquitectura de instrucciones que impulsa la innovación en el mundo de la computación.

Índice de Contenido
  1. ¿Qué es RISC-V?
  2. La inspiración de los pioneros
  3. La revelación de RISC-V
  4. Las ventajas de RISC-V
    1. ¿Qué es RISC-V?
    2. ¿Cuáles son las ventajas de esta ACI?
  5. Beneficios adicionales de RISC-V
    1. ¿Cómo funciona RISC-V y cómo se diferencia de las ACI tradicionales?
  6. Aplicaciones para consumidores y empresas
  7. Metas para el ecosistema
  8. Recomendaciones para aprender y entrenarse
  9. El futuro de RISC-V
  10. Recursos para aprender más sobre componentes y procesos de RISC-V

¿Qué es RISC-V?

RISC-V es una arquitectura de conjunto de instrucciones (ACI) que ofrece mecanismos operativos innovadores. Aprende sobre su origen y las ventajas que proporciona.

La inspiración de los pioneros

La novela fascinante de Steven Levy, "Hackers: Héroes de la Revolución Informática", es una lectura imprescindible para cualquier tecnólogo o persona apasionada por el campo de la informática. Centrándose en los verdaderos geeks de la informática en el MIT a fines de la década de 1950, el libro explora en detalle las especificaciones de hardware primitivas -y realmente pintorescas- de las primeras computadoras, que en ese momento podían hacer relativamente poco pero que allanaron el camino para hazañas mucho mayores.

La lectura sobre la pasión de los pioneros en el campo de la informática, algunos de los cuales se obsesionaron tanto con la tecnología que se convirtió en una obsesión, nunca deja de inspirarme. Como resultado, optimizar las capacidades del hardware ha sido durante mucho tiempo uno de mis pasatiempos; ajustar y personalizar para aprovechar al máximo los componentes del sistema y lograr los mejores resultados.

La revelación de RISC-V

Uno de los elementos que descubrí recientemente se llama RISC-V, que es una arquitectura de conjunto de instrucciones informáticas única. Desarrollada en 2010, RISC-V ofrece muchas ventajas para consumidores y empresas.

Las ventajas de RISC-V

Discutí estas ventajas con Mark Himelstein, CTO de RISC-V, una organización que busca promover la arquitectura de conjunto de instrucciones RISC-V.

Cómo simular un clic derecho desde el teclado en Windows

¿Qué es RISC-V?

RISC-V es una arquitectura de conjunto de instrucciones (ACI) libre y abierta que permite una nueva era de innovación de procesadores a través de la colaboración de estándares abiertos. Nacida en el ámbito académico y de la investigación, la ACI RISC-V ofrece un nuevo nivel de libertad de software y hardware extensibles en arquitectura, allanando el camino para los próximos 50 años de diseño e innovación en informática.

¿Cuáles son las ventajas de esta ACI?

RISC-V tiene una variedad de ventajas, incluyendo su apertura, simplicidad, diseño desde cero, modularidad, extensibilidad y estabilidad, a diferencia de las ACI antiguas que no están diseñadas para manejar las últimas cargas de trabajo informáticas. En RISC-V International, seguimos observando cómo RISC-V:

  1. Habilita la innovación: RISC-V es una ACI en capas y extensible, lo que permite a las empresas implementar fácilmente el conjunto de instrucciones mínimo, extensiones bien definidas y extensiones personalizadas para crear procesadores personalizados para cargas de trabajo de vanguardia.
  2. Reduce el riesgo y la inversión: al permitir a las empresas aprovechar bloques de construcción de propiedad intelectual establecidos y comunes con el creciente conjunto de herramientas compartidas y recursos de desarrollo de la comunidad.
  3. Proporciona flexibilidad para personalizar el procesador: dado que la implementación no se define a nivel de ACI, sino más bien por la composición del sistema en un chip (SoC) y otros atributos de diseño, los ingenieros pueden personalizar los conjuntos de chips para que sean grandes, pequeños, potentes o livianos según lo que necesiten los dispositivos.
  4. Acelera el tiempo de comercialización a través de la colaboración y la reutilización de IP de código abierto: RISC-V no solo reduce los gastos de desarrollo, sino que también permite a las empresas lanzar sus diseños al mercado más rápido.

Al final del día, hay algunas cosas que realmente importan: tener la capacidad de ejecutar las mismas aplicaciones en diferentes implementaciones y poder ejecutar el mismo sistema operativo/hipervisor en diferentes implementaciones.

Beneficios adicionales de RISC-V

Además de los muchos beneficios que RISC-V ofrece a las empresas, la arquitectura simple de ACI de base fija y las extensiones estándar fijas modulares también facilitan a los investigadores, profesores y estudiantes aprovechar RISC-V para aprender y ampliar los límites del diseño.

¿Cómo funciona RISC-V y cómo se diferencia de las ACI tradicionales?

Mientras que algunas ACI cerradas y propietarias tienen costosas tarifas de licencia, la ACI RISC-V es gratuita y está abierta para su uso por cualquier persona en todo tipo de implementaciones, sin restricciones. RISC-V fue diseñada intencionalmente para tener una ACI base pequeña y fija, junto con extensiones estándar fijas modulares que funcionan bien para la mayoría del código. Esto deja amplio espacio para extensiones específicas de la aplicación, sin interferir con el núcleo estándar de la ACI.

Tener una arquitectura base simple ayuda a evitar la fragmentación y también admite la personalización. Muchas empresas están aprovechando RISC-V para crear procesadores personalizados diseñados para manejar los requisitos de potencia y rendimiento de las nuevas cargas de trabajo para aplicaciones de inteligencia artificial (IA), aprendizaje automático (ML), Internet de las cosas (IoT) y aplicaciones de realidad virtual (VR) y realidad aumentada (AR).

10 atajos de teclado para Windows que debes conocer

Aplicaciones para consumidores y empresas

RISC-V es ideal para una amplia variedad de aplicaciones integradas, desde aplicaciones de IoT hasta dispositivos informáticos (como discos), aplicaciones automotrices y controladores informáticos (como gráficos). RISC-V también se está utilizando para procesadores personalizados orientados a aplicaciones desde el borde de la red hasta servidores en la nube, con aplicaciones específicas dedicadas a la informática de alto rendimiento (HPC). Además, estamos viendo un interés en RISC-V para procesadores de propósito general para laptops, computadoras de escritorio y centros de datos, con escalabilidad vertical y horizontal.

Metas para el ecosistema

Mis metas para la comunidad RISC-V son expandir la colaboración y el desarrollo en todos los mercados. Con el fin de fortalecer la comunidad y el acceso a los recursos de RISC-V, mi objetivo es: habilitar mercados verticales desde la pila de software del sistema hasta la pila de software de aplicaciones; permitir el software de código abierto y de código cerrado desde la verificación del diseño hasta los sistemas operativos y las aplicaciones, y permitir a empresas y particulares compartir fácilmente diseños para silicio, propiedad intelectual de software suave, placas, sistemas, software y más.

Recomendaciones para aprender y entrenarse

Alentamos a cualquier persona interesada en RISC-V a consultar el material educativo en nuestro sitio web, donde tenemos enlaces a conferencias, tutoriales en video y otros recursos útiles. Además, la comunidad global de RISC-V regularmente organiza encuentros (tanto presenciales como en línea), donde todos tienen la oportunidad de aprender sobre soluciones, proyectos e implementaciones de RISC-V.

El futuro de RISC-V

El futuro verá una explosión de aplicaciones diseñadas con RISC-V. Nuestros diseños flexibles, escalables y con licencia de código abierto, junto con nuestra arquitectura de diseño moderna (diseñada desde la base), impulsarán nuestro crecimiento en membresía e implementaciones planificadas. Esperamos el inicio de implementaciones en volumen en la segunda mitad de 2021 y en 2022. Hemos logrado un progreso increíble en los últimos años, aprovechando este momento único de la historia. Desde hace más de 30 años, hemos desarrollado software de código abierto y más de 40 años de ACIs y productos resultantes. Arrancamos con fuerza, y ahora hay más de 685 miembros de RISC-V International. En nuestro sitio web, hay más de 90 productos de hardware basados en RISC-V de diferentes empresas, y una variedad de placas de desarrollo listas para usar (OTS) por menos de $50 para proyectos embebidos pequeños, además de placas por menos de $500 que ejecutan Linux.

Recursos para aprender más sobre componentes y procesos de RISC-V

El sitio web riscv.org es un excelente recurso para aprender más sobre la ACI RISC-V junto con las placas, núcleos y sistemas en un chip (SoC) disponibles para diseñadores. El sitio también enumera herramientas de depuración, compiladores de C, configuración, herramientas de verificación, kits de desarrollo de software (SDK) y otras herramientas de software en el ecosistema de RISC-V. La página de GitHub de RISC-V también es un recurso excelente.

Además, RISC-V International anunció recientemente el Programa de Socios de Capacitación RISC-V, que incluye ofertas de capacitación de diferentes organizaciones. Los participantes tienen la oportunidad de ampliar el alcance de sus conocimientos de RISC-V y aprender más sobre los beneficios de la colaboración abierta. También existen una serie de cursos educativos sobre RISC-V en universidades de todo el mundo.

Guía rápida para identificar diferentes tipos de chips de RAM

En Newsmatic nos especializamos en tecnología de vanguardia, contamos con los artículos mas novedosos sobre Hardware, allí encontraras muchos artículos similares a RISC-V: La arquitectura de instrucciones que impulsa la innovación en el mundo de la computación. , tenemos lo ultimo en tecnología 2023.

Artículos Relacionados

Subir

Utilizamos cookies para mejorar su experiencia de navegación, mostrarle anuncios o contenidos personalizados y analizar nuestro tráfico. Al hacer clic en “Aceptar todo” usted da su consentimiento a nuestro uso de las cookies.